The Nature of God
Ten years before that, Joseph Smith had a desire and a question about which church to join, and as he knelt in prayer, he beheld a vision of God the Father and Jesus Christ. Joseph prayed to know what was right so he could do what was right. Joseph asked in faith and was determined to act in accordance with the answers he received. They instructed him that he would “restore all things.”
From this vision, Elder Bednar declares, “Joseph Smith learned the vital lessons about the attributes, character, and perfections of the Godhead—and that the Father and the Son are separate and distinct Beings. Jesus Christ is the literal Son of God in spirit and in the flesh.”
Elder Bednar testifies that “The visitation of the Father and the Son to Joseph Smith was the initiating event in the grand ‘restoration of all things spoken by the mouth of all the holy prophets since the world began.’”

The Restoration of the Priesthood
The Savior fulfilled the Old Testament Law of Moses when He was born, preached, established the church, was crucified, and was resurrected. He ordained his apostles with His power, the priesthood, to go out and preach the “good news” to the world. They did, until they were all killed, and the authority was taken from the earth. Jesus Christ needed to restore His church on earth, and He did that through the Prophet Joseph Smith.
Elder Bednar points out that “Priesthood authority allows God’s servants to 'represent [Him] and act in His name.’ Priesthood keys are the authority to direct the use of the priesthood on behalf of God’s children.”
With the restoration of the keys of the priesthood through resurrected beings, such as John the Baptist, comes the authority to baptize by immersion for the remission of sins. Peter, James, and John restored the apostleship and additional priesthood authority and keys.”
Six years after the Church was established, in the Kirtland Temple, Moses, Elias, and Elijah committed to Joseph the additional authority necessary to accomplish God’s work in the latter days. Specifically:
Moses committed the keys of the Israelite gathering.
Elias committed the dispensation of the gospel of Abraham, including the restoration of the Abrahamic covenant.
Elijah committed the keys of the sealing power, providing the authority that allows ordinances performed on earth to be binding in eternity, such as joining families together in eternal relationships that transcend death.
